List of usage examples for org.apache.hadoop.yarn.server.resourcemanager.scheduler.event NodeRemovedSchedulerEvent getRemovedRMNode
public RMNode getRemovedRMNode()
From source file:org.apache.myriad.policy.LeastAMNodesFirstPolicy.java
License:Apache License
private void onNodeRemoved(NodeRemovedSchedulerEvent event) { SchedulerNode schedulerNode = schedulerNodes.get(event.getRemovedRMNode().getNodeID().getHost()); if (schedulerNode != null && schedulerNode.getNodeID().equals(event.getRemovedRMNode().getNodeID())) { schedulerNodes.remove(schedulerNode.getNodeID().getHost()); }//from w w w. ja va 2 s .c om }